When loading a steam sterilizer, basins should be (A) placed in an upright position. (B) loaded first. (C) placed on edge. (D) placed in a wire basket. C The higher the bioburden on an object (A) the more difficult it will be to sterilize. (B) the less time it will take to sterilize it. (C) the more biological tests will be needed in the load. (D) the longer it will take to cool after sterilization. A When combining loads, hard goods should be placed on the top shelves to allow for more efficient removal of the condensate. (A) True (B) False B The steam sterilization process can be affected by the design of the medical device being sterilized. (A) True (B) False A Central Service technicians need to understand the anatomy of a steam sterilizer to (A) know how to properly clean the chamber. (B) understand how the sterilizer operates. (C) understand how to test the thermostatic trap. (D) know how to properly maintain the jacket. B The weakest part of a steam sterilizer is the (A) jacket. (B) gasket. (C) door. (D) thermostatic valve. C Three of the main phases of a terminal steam sterilizer cycle are (A) gravity, exposure and exhaust. (B) pre-vacuum, exposure and exhaust. (C) exposure, exhaust and dry. (D) conditioning, exposure and exhaust. D The most common reason for steam sterilization failure is (A) lack of steam contact with the instrument. (B) insufficient temperature. (C) inadequate exposure time. (D) drying issues. A The coolest place in a steam sterilizer is the (A) gasket. (B) thermostatic trap. (C) jacket. (D) chamber. B Steam flush pressure pulse sterilizers are a type of gravity sterilizers. (A) True (B) False B Factors that can cause sterilant contact failure with the instrument are (A) cleaning, loosely packed load. (B) conditioning, size and weight of the instrument. (C) solid bottom containers, exposure time. (D) crowded loads, clogged drain strainer. D One of the most frequent causes of a clogged drain screen is (A) tape. (B) wrapper particles. (C) poor steam quality. (D) malfunctioning baffle plate. A After sterilization the load contents may take two hours or more to cool. (A) True (B) False A Peel pouches should be placed (blank) for sterilization (A) on edge, paper to plastic. (B) on edge, plastic to plastic. (C) placed flat with the plastic side up. (D) placed flat with the paper side up. A Items with a standard steam sterilization cycle recommended by the manufacturer can be damaged if run in an extended cycle. (A) True (B) False A How frequently should a sterilizer's strainer be removed and cleaned? (A) Daily (B) After each use (C) Once weekly (D) Only when the machine's operating control gauge indicates cleaning is necessary A
